Connect to Parquet Data in as an External Source in Dremio



Use the CData JDBC Driver to connect to Parquet as an External Source in Dremio.

The CData JDBC Driver for Parquet implements JDBC Standards and allows various applications, including Dremio, to work with live Parquet data. Dremio is a data lakehouse platform designed to empower self-service, interactive analytics on the data lake. With the CData JDBC Driver, you can include live Parquet data as a part of your enterprise data lake. This article describes how to connect to Parquet data from Dremio as an External Source.

Build the ARP Connector

To use the CData JDBC Driver in Dremio, you need to build an Advanced Relation Pushdown (ARP) Connector. You can view the source code for the Connector on GitHub or download the ZIP file (GitHub.com) directly. Once you copy or extract the files, run the following command from the root directory of the connector (the directory containing the pom.xml file) to build the connector.

mvn clean install

Once the JAR file for the connector is built (in the target directory), you are ready to copy the ARP connector and JDBC Driver to your Dremio instance.

Installing the Connector and JDBC Driver

Install the ARP Connector to %DREMIO_HOME%/jars/ and the JDBC Driver for Parquet to %DREMIO_HOME%/jars/3rdparty. You can use commands similar to the following:

ARP Connector

docker cp PATH\TO\dremio-parquet-plugin-20.0.0.jar dremio_image_name:/opt/dremio/jars/

JDBC Driver for Parquet

docker cp PATH\TO\cdata.jdbc.parquet.jar dremio_image_name:/opt/dremio/jars/3rdparty/

Connecting to Parquet

Parquet will now appear as an External Source option in Dremio. The ARP Connector built uses a JDBC URL to connect to Parquet data. The JDBC Driver has a built-in connection string designer that you can use (see below).

Built-in Connection String Designer

For assistance in constructing the JDBC URL, use the connection string designer built into the Parquet JDBC Driver. Double-click the JAR file or execute the jar file from the command line.

java -jar cdata.jdbc.parquet.jar

Fill in the connection properties and copy the connection string to the clipboard.

Connect to your local Parquet file(s) by setting the URI connection property to the location of the Parquet file.

NOTE: To use the JDBC Driver in Dremio, you will need a license (full or trial) and a Runtime Key (RTK). For more information on obtaining this license (or a trial), contact our sales team.

Add the Runtime Key (RTK) to the JDBC URL. You will end up with a JDBC URL similar to the following:

jdbc:parquet:RTK=5246...;URI=C:/folder/table.parquet;

Access Parquet as an External Source

To add Parquet as an External Source, click to add a new source and select Parquet. Copy the JDBC URL and paste it into the New Parquet Source wizard.

Save the connection and you are ready to query live Parquet data in Dremio, easily incorporating Parquet data into your data lake.
